  • Patent number: 11296635
    Abstract: A control system for motor configured to control currents supplied to an armature coil and a field coil properly to achieve a required torque. The control system controls torque of a rotor by controlling a base torque generated by energizing an armature coil, and a field torque generated by energizing a field coil. When a target torque is equal to or greater than a predetermined torque, the controller controls the base torque and the field torque such that a ratio of the field torque to the target torque is increased greater than that of a case in which the target torque is less than the predetermined torque.

  • Patent number: 10781758
    Abstract: A control device is for an internal combustion engine including a throttle valve and a variable valve mechanism, and configured to be operated at a prescribed target air-fuel ratio and capable of restarting from an intermittent stop. The control device includes an electronic control unit configured to start the internal combustion engine after starting an intake air amount reduction control, when a fuel injection amount equal to or larger than a prescribed amount is required and an intermittent stop time is equal to or longer than a prescribed time in a case of the restart from the intermittent stop. The intermittent stop time is a stop time from an immediately preceding intermittent stop to a current restart of the internal combustion engine. The intake air amount reduction control is a control of reducing the intake air amount by operating the variable valve mechanism with the throttle valve kept fully closed.

  • Patent number: 10669979
    Abstract: A control device is configured to read a required operation point of the internal combustion engine at the moment of restart following after intermittent stoppage, and to execute, when it is determined that the required operation point belongs to a reduced-cylinder operation allowed region and also to a reduced-cylinder operation restricted region which lies on a high load side of the reduced-cylinder operation allowed region, an all-cylinder operation and then move into a reduced-cylinder operation. When it is determined that the required operation point belongs to the reduced-cylinder operation allowed region but not to the reduced-cylinder operation restricted region, the control device is configured to switch the engine to the reduced-cylinder operation without execution of the all-cylinder operation.

  • Patent number: 10363919
    Abstract: A control apparatus for the hybrid vehicle is provided with: a first switcher configured to switch between a HV running mode in which the internal combustion engine is operated for the hybrid vehicle to run, and an EV running mode in which the internal combustion engine is stopped and the power of the power source is used for the hybrid vehicle to run; a second switcher configured to switch between a first mode and a second mode in which an acceleration performance is emphasized more than in the first mode; and a controller programmed to control the transmission in such a manner that the transmission stage in a particular state in which the EV running mode and the second mode are selected is reduced in comparison with the transmission stage when the hybrid vehicle is not in the particular state.

  • Patent number: 9714026
    Abstract: A control apparatus for a hybrid vehicle is provided with a first charge controlling device configured to maintain output of an internal combustion engine at a predetermined value or more, and to charge a power storing device with an output excess with respect to an output request for the internal combustion engine. The control apparatus includes a second charge controlling device configured to charge the power storing device with an output increment caused by upshift of a gear shifting device. The control apparatus further includes a transmission time changing device configured to extend an execution time of the upshift or to delay start timing of the upshift, in order to prevent charge power for the power storing device from exceeding an input limit value for the power storing device, if the control time of the output reduction request overlaps the control time of the upshift request.

  • Patent number: 9610938
    Abstract: A control apparatus, which is configured to control a hybrid vehicle, is provided with: a device configured to determine whether or not there is a response delay of the supercharger; a device configured to control torque of the rotary electric machine to compensate for an insufficiency of torque of a drive shaft if there is the response delay when an output limit value of the battery is greater than or equal to a predetermined value; a device configured to estimate a NOx storage amount in the NOx storage/reduction catalyst; and a device configured to control an air-fuel ratio of the internal combustion engine to be rich if the NOx storage amount is greater than or equal to a predetermined value, or if there is the response delay when the output limit value of the battery is less than the predetermined value.

  • Patent number: 9604528
    Abstract: A control apparatus is applied to a hybrid vehicle including an internal combustion engine that is capable of changing over its combustion state between lean combustion and stoichiometric combustion. The control apparatus executes noise suppression control by limiting the operating point of the internal combustion engine to be upon a noise suppression line for lean combustion or to be upon a noise suppression line for stoichiometric combustion, so that the noise generated by a power transmission mechanism is suppressed. When changing over from lean combustion to stoichiometric combustion during execution of noise suppression control, the control apparatus of the present invention changes the air/fuel ratio after changing the operating point of the internal combustion engine from one point to a point that is more toward the lower torque side of the noise suppression line.

  • Patent number: 9533676
    Abstract: An electronic control unit included in a control system is configured to execute a change of a combustion mode in an inertia-phase period during a gear shift operation, or after the gear shift operation is completed, when a request for the change of the combustion mode and a request for a gear shift of the transmission mechanism overlap. The electronic control unit is configured to execute the change of the combustion mode in the inertia-phase period during the gear shift operation when conditions i) and ii) are established, and execute the change of the combustion mode after the gear shift operation is completed when conditions i) and iii) are established. The aforementioned conditions include: i) the change of the combustion mode is accompanied by an increase in engine power; ii) the power running mode is executed during the gear shift operation; and iii) the regeneration mode is executed during the gear shift operation.

  • Patent number: 9527497
    Abstract: A control device according to the invention moves an operation point of an internal combustion engine such that a distribution of engine torque with respect to required torque is reduced and then carries out air-fuel ratio control for reducing an air-fuel ratio of the internal combustion engine in a case where an operation mode of the internal combustion engine should be switched from a lean combustion mode to a stoichiometric combustion mode.

  • Patent number: 9434376
    Abstract: The control apparatus of the present invention is applied to a hybrid vehicle that, as power sources for propulsion, includes an internal combustion engine that can change over between lean combustion and stoichiometric combustion, and motor-generators. The control apparatus performs the noise suppression control in which the operating points of the internal combustion engine are limited so as to suppress noise generated by a power transmission mechanism, and changes over the operational mode of the internal combustion engine if the thermal efficiency when performing the noise suppression control by changing over the operational mode of the internal combustion engine is higher than the thermal efficiency when performing the noise suppression control by keeping the operational mode of the internal combustion engine the same.

  • Patent number: 9248830
    Abstract: The control apparatus of the present invention is applied to a hybrid vehicle having an internal combustion engine that is capable, during operation, of changing over its operational mode to lean combustion or to stoichiometric combustion. The control apparatus preferentially selects an operational mode having high system efficiency in relation to the requested power, and selects the stoichiometric combustion mode (S104) when, under the specific condition that the system efficiency is higher in the lean combustion mode as compared to the EV mode and moreover is lower in the stoichiometric combustion mode as compared to the EV mode, also the temperature (Tnc) of an exhaust purification catalyst is less than or equal to a first predetermined value (T?) (S101, S102).

  • Publication number: 20150369144
    Abstract: A control apparatus for a vehicle is provided. The vehicle includes an engine and a transmission. The transmission is configured to continuously change an engine operating point that is defined by a rotational speed of the engine and a torque of the engine. The control apparatus includes an ECU. The ECU is configured to, when a target engine required power increases in response to a reacceleration operation, set the rotational speed and the torque so as to reach a power of the engine to the target engine required power while holding the rotational speed equal to or higher than the rotational speed at a time of the reacceleration operation. The ECU is configured to control the engine operating point based on the set rotational speed and the set torque.
